Active

DOB: April 1965

Country of Residence: England

Nationality: British

Address: 4, Lombard Street, London, EC3V 9AA,

Appointments

Company Appointment Date Position / Occupation
ALPHA BETA PARTNERS LIMITED (10963905) 26/02/2018 Company Director